The Aiken Department of Public Safety will be conducting its fourth Safe Communities Offender Notification this evening at 6:00PM, in the City of Aiken Council Chambers, 214 Park Avenue NW. The offender notifications are an important part of the Safe Communities crime-reduction initiative. Offenders are identified based on their present and past criminal activities. Offenders attend a meeting with law enforcement officials and community members to hear the effects of the crimes they are committing. Offenders are also given, in writing, the penalties they face if they commit another crime. They are offered opportunities to connect with area service providers and nonprofit organizations to help them to pursue a different, more productive, path. Those choosing to seek help from their community have proven this method works because instead of re-offending, they become contributors, not takers. The public is invited to attend this notification. Those wishing to attend are asked to be seated in the council chambers by 6:00PM.
